Software developer salaries in Greece have risen steadily as demand outpaces local supply. Greek employers must offer competitive packages aligned with the Labour Code requirements to attract top engineering talent.
The minimum salary threshold for tech professionals in Greece starts at €780 per month (Greek minimum wage), with most senior software developer roles earning well above this baseline. Working software developers typically earn €2,500 to €6,500 per month, depending on experience, specialisation, and location. Athens commands the highest salaries, while remote-friendly and regional roles trend slightly lower.

The EU Blue Card is the primary route for highly qualified non-EU developers seeking to work in Greece. Applicants need a recognised university degree (or equivalent professional experience), a binding Greek job offer, and a salary above the Greek EU Blue Card threshold. AtoZ Serwis Plus handles the complete EU Blue Card application through the Greek Ministry of Migration and Asylum, including document gathering, certified translations, and employer attestations. Approved holders receive long-term residence rights with intra-EU mobility after 18 months.
For non-EU/EEA developers, we coordinate the national D visa or equivalent long-stay entry visa required to enter Greece. Senior developers relocating with families benefit from Greek family reunification provisions, with spouses gaining work authorisation in most cases.
After qualifying periods of legal residence in Greece (typically 5 years for permanent residence), software developers can pursue long-term status. Most Greek agencies charge a percentage of the candidate's annual salary, usually between 15 and 25 per cent for permanent placements. Contractor placements, retained executive search, and RPO services use different pricing models based on Greek market rates.
Entry-level and mid-level developer roles typically take 4 to 10 weeks, including the processing of the Greek residence permit for employment. Senior engineering and Greek executive search assignments can take 3 to 6 months. Bulk team hiring for Greek scaleups typically takes 8 to 16 weeks, depending on visa requirements.

Software developer candidates typically need a valid passport, a signed Greek employment contract, recognised IT or computer science qualifications or evidence of equivalent professional experience, a criminal record certificate from the country of origin, proof of accommodation in Greece, valid health insurance, passport photographs, and the application fee. Documents not in the official Greek language(s) require certified translation. The Greek Ministry of Migration and Asylum provides the complete, up-to-date document checklist on migration.gov.gr.
